Pygmy sundew is a small carnivorous plant requiring a moist, acidic soil environment and full sun to partial shade for optimal growth. Special care points for pygmy sundew include maintaining high humidity and ensuring the soil never dries out completely. Regular feeding is not necessary as pygmy sundew captures its own prey, but it may benefit from occasional feeding if insects are scarce.
